This Kent & Stowe 1.3m Long Reach Easy Pruner allows you to trim high tree branches with one hand. Their premium carbon steel blades are non-stick, giving a smoother cut, and they are also rust resistant for longevity. Furthermore, this pruner comes with a 5 year guarantee.   • Premium ground carbon steel blades with non-stick PTFE coating for rust resistance and a smoother cut
  • Designed for single handed use with bypass action blade
  • Allows you to trim high tree branches with one hand, without a ladder or rope required.
  • Can also be used to prune harder to reach places and at the back of beds and borders
  • Cutting diameter: 18mm
  • 5 year guarantee

How to maintain and care for your Garden Tools

 

It is very important to take proper care of your garden tool so that it continues to perform at its peak. Do not leave your tool outside, always store it away after use in a dry environment. Even in dry weather conditions your tools, if left outside, are exposed to moisture from wet grass and dew.

Cleaning and drying your garden tools will keep them in good working order. Always remove all of the soil from your digging tools after each use by washing the dirt off.

Never put your tools away wet. Allow them to dry completely before storing to prevent rusting and handle rot. For all wood handled tools apply a light coating of boiled linseed oil to help prevent the wood from drying out and cracking. If a wooden handle is very dirty, remove as much of the soil as possible with a stiff brush. If you need to use water, gently wet the handle with a damp cloth, making sure that you don’t soak the wood, as this may cause the grain to lift and the handle to swell.

Thoroughly clean any tools which have been used for chemical applications. Fertilisers and other chemicals will rapidly corrode any metal.

  • Suitable for cutting delicate stems, as the bypass action is less likely to cause bruising and damage to the stems
  • Ideal for picking fruits and flowers, trimming thorn bushes, twigs, stems and high branches
  • Use to assist cutting tasks without a ladder or rope
